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: (1)Japanese patient with anticoagulant therapy for non valvular atrial fibliration (2)Patient with 20 years old and older (3)Patient signed Informed consent

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: (1)Patient recieved or will recieve catheter ablation during follow up. (2)Patient recieved catheter ablation for atrial fibliration in the past 6 month. (3)In patient with cancer, not noticed of cancer at the time of informed consent. (4)Patient judged unsuitable for the study by prncipal investigator or subinvetigator

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
We investigate the new events of stroke and/or systemic embolism by the type of anticoagulant and therapy (medicine vs non medicine) during follow-up period of 12M after informed cocent.

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
Death(cardiovascular death/non-cardiovascular death), stroke(ischemic/hemorrhagic/unclassified), systemic embolism, cardiovascular event(acute myocardial infarction/unstable angina), hemorrhagic event (intracranial bleeding except hemorrhagic stroke, gastrointestinal bleeding), adverse event, others
